The Role of Budgeting Frameworks

Effective budgeting frameworks are crucial in managing the complex costs associated with federal AI initiatives. Utilizing zero-based budgeting or activity-based costing allows agencies to scrutinize every dollar spent and ensures resources are allocated efficiently. By implementing these frameworks, decision-makers can align spending with strategic objectives and improve transparency across projects.

Key Strategies for Cost Reduction

Implementing Agile Methodologies to Enhance Cost-Effectiveness in AI Development

Agile methodologies offer flexibility and adaptability, allowing federal agencies to respond swiftly to changing requirements. By delivering incremental results through iterative cycles, they minimize the risk of overinvestment in non-essential features while enhancing stakeholder satisfaction.

Incorporating agile practices can lead to substantial savings by ensuring that resources are allocated efficiently throughout the project lifecycle. The U.S. Department of Defense provides a compelling case study with its transition to agile methodologies for AI development projects. This shift has not only improved time-to-market but also reduced costs significantly by avoiding large-scale changes late in the development cycle.

Case Study: Agile at the Department of Defense

The DoD’s adoption of agile frameworks like SAFe (Scaled Agile Framework) and DSDM (Dynamic Systems Development Method) illustrates successful cost optimization. These methodologies have streamlined processes, improved cross-functional collaboration, and enhanced project predictability, resulting in substantial budget savings.

Leveraging Cloud Computing Solutions to Minimize Expenses in Federal AI Initiatives

Cloud computing has revolutionized how federal agencies manage data and computational resources. By leveraging cloud solutions, agencies can significantly reduce capital expenditure on hardware and operational costs associated with maintaining physical servers.

The National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ST) has been a pioneer in promoting cloud-based architectures for AI applications. NIST’s framework emphasizes the importance of security, scalability, and cost-effectiveness when transitioning to cloud environments. By adopting these principles, federal agencies can optimize their IT infrastructure while ensuring compliance with stringent data protection regulations.

Real-World Example: Cloud Adoption at NASA

NASA provides an excellent example of successful cloud adoption in federal AI projects. Through its partnership with Silicon Valley tech giants like Amazon Web Services (AWS), NASA has managed to reduce costs by 30% on its high-performance computing needs. This collaboration highlights the potential for cost savings and innovation when leveraging private sector expertise.

Collaborative Innovation as a Cost-Saving Measure

Collaboration is key to maximizing resources and minimizing waste in federal AI projects. By partnering with academic institutions, industry leaders, and other government agencies, federal bodies can pool knowledge, share costs, and accelerate the development of innovative solutions.

The DoD’s collaboration with Silicon Valley tech companies on AI research has led to breakthroughs that might have been cost-prohibitive if pursued independently. These partnerships not only lower financial barriers but also foster an ecosystem of continuous innovation and learning.

Additional Actionable Insights and Practical Advice

  1. Conduct Regular Cost-Benefit Analyses: Regularly evaluate the ongoing costs and benefits of AI projects to ensure they remain aligned with strategic goals. This practice helps identify areas where resources can be reallocated for greater impact.
  2. Invest in Training and Development: Equip teams with the skills necessary to implement cost-saving technologies effectively. Continuous learning ensures that personnel are adept at using new tools, which enhances efficiency and reduces errors.
  3. Adopt Modular AI Systems: Implementing modular systems allows agencies to upgrade or modify components without overhauling entire systems. This approach can significantly reduce long-term costs by facilitating incremental improvements.
  4. Explore Open Source Solutions: Utilizing open-source software for AI projects can cut down licensing fees and promote collaborative enhancements from the global tech community.
  5. Monitor Technological Trends: Stay informed about emerging technologies that could offer cost efficiencies or new opportunities for innovation in federal AI initiatives.

The landscape of AI development is continuously evolving, with trends such as edge computing, quantum computing, and federated learning gaining traction. These innovations promise to further optimize costs by enhancing efficiency and reducing reliance on centralized resources.

  1. Edge Computing: By processing data closer to its source, edge computing reduces the need for extensive cloud infrastructure, thereby lowering costs associated with data transmission and storage.
  2. Quantum Computing: As quantum technology matures, it has the potential to revolutionize AI by solving complex problems more efficiently than classical computers, which could lead to significant cost reductions.
  3. Federated Learning: This approach enables machine learning models to be trained across multiple decentralized devices or servers holding local data samples without exchanging them. It offers enhanced privacy and security while reducing costs related to data centralization.
